DSP/ RBT Job Description
Location: Fairfield
Pay range: $26 to $28 per hour
Assist Adults with intellectual and developmental disabilities with acquiring, retaining, improving, and generalizing the behavioral, self-help, socialization, and adaptive skills necessary to function successfully in the home and community. Behavior Technicians will provide services directly to the youth in their homes using Positive Behavior Supports, and instruction in Daily and Independent Living Skills.
Responsibilities:
Provide Applied Behavior Analysis skills to youth and/or adults
Train/coach individuals and their families in daily living skills, behavior management, parenting, socialization, and other identified needs
Advocate for the individuals and their families
Provide input into assessments, case conferences, and treatment plans
Crisis prevention, recognition, and intervention
Staff meeting attendance
Ensure all agency policies are implemented and followed
Complete progress notes within 24 hours of service provision
Communicate and confirm the schedule
Complete required pieces of training

Minimum Qualification Requirements including education, experience, licensure/certification, etc. and essential physical capabilities (e.g. lifting, assisting lifting, standing, etc.)
Minimum requirements may vary by state of employment and/or contract. Please refer to applicable regulations for all DSP/RBT requirements for state of employment.
All DSP/RBTs must meet the following minimum requirements:
- HS diploma or its educational equivalent
- Valid Driver’s License may be required, based on position/location
- Must hold or obtain Registered Behavior Technician (RBT) certification within one year of appointment (or be a Licensed Psych Technician or Qualified Behavior Modification Professional, for California assignments)
- Basic written and verbal communication skills
- Basic computer skills – including email, utilizing Workday and related systems (DA, etc.) to complete tasks
- Interpersonal and problem-solving skills
- Willingness to take initiative
- Ability to meet essential physical demands of position, including frequent walking, sitting, standing, bending, twisting, stooping, kneeling, crouching, pushing, pulling and reaching with hands and arms; use hands to handle, finger or feel objects, tools or controls; assisting with lifting/moving individuals of any weight with or without assistance of equipment and/or other staff; lifting and/or moving up to 25 pounds on occasion; having the physical capacity to work with and implement emergency interventions as per the person’s Individual Behavior Support Plan and Individual Emergency Intervention Plan, if/as needed.
